1. Understanding Ba Be Lake and Its Appeal
Ba Be Lake, located in Bac Kan Province, is Vietnam’s largest natural freshwater lake and a vital part of Ba Be National Park. Formed over 200 million years ago, the lake is surrounded by towering limestone karsts and lush forests, creating a breathtaking landscape. Its tranquil waters and diverse ecosystem make it a popular destination for nature lovers and adventurers.
- Unique Biodiversity: Ba Be Lake is home to a rich variety of flora and fauna, including many rare and endangered species. The national park is a critical biodiversity hotspot, attracting researchers and conservationists from around the world.
- Cultural Significance: The area around Ba Be Lake is inhabited by several ethnic minority groups, including the Tay, Nung, and Dao people, each with their unique cultures and traditions. Visitors have the opportunity to experience authentic Vietnamese culture and hospitality.
- Tourism Potential: With its stunning natural beauty and cultural richness, Ba Be Lake is a rising star in Vietnam’s tourism scene. Sustainable tourism practices are essential to preserve the lake’s natural environment and support local communities.
2. Designated Swimming Areas in Ba Be Lake
While Ba Be Lake is inviting, swimming is only permitted in specific areas to ensure safety and environmental protection. These designated spots are carefully chosen for their accessibility, water quality, and suitability for swimming activities.
- Why Designated Areas? Limiting swimming to designated areas helps minimize the impact on the lake’s fragile ecosystem. It also allows for better monitoring of water quality and ensures that swimmers have access to safe and clean areas.
- Popular Swimming Spots: Some of the most popular swimming spots in Ba Be Lake include areas near Pac Ngoi Village and around the lake’s main tourist centers. These areas often have small beaches or docks where visitors can easily access the water.
- Local Regulations: It’s essential to follow local regulations and guidelines when swimming in Ba Be Lake. These rules are designed to protect both visitors and the environment, so be sure to familiarize yourself with them before taking a dip.

9. Nearby Attractions to Ba Be Lake
While Ba Be Lake is the main attraction, there are several other nearby attractions that are worth exploring.
-
Ba Be National Park: Explore the diverse ecosystems of Ba Be National Park, including forests, waterfalls, and caves. The park is home to many rare and endangered species.
-
Puong Cave: Visit Puong Cave, a stunning cave system that is home to thousands of bats. Take a boat tour through the cave to see its impressive stalactites and stalagmites.
-
Hua Ma Cave: Explore Hua Ma Cave, also known as Fairy Cave, which features impressive rock formations and a rich history.
-
Dau Dang Waterfall: Visit Dau Dang Waterfall, a series of cascading waterfalls surrounded by lush forests. The waterfall is a popular spot for picnics and relaxation.
-
Pac Ngoi Village: Experience the traditional culture of the Tay people in Pac Ngoi Village, a charming village located on the shores of Ba Be Lake.
-
An Ma Temple: Visit An Ma Temple, located on a small island in the middle of Ba Be Lake. The temple is a peaceful place to reflect and enjoy the surrounding scenery.

11. Cultural Etiquette Tips for Visiting Ba Be Lake
Understanding and respecting local customs can greatly enhance your experience in Ba Be Lake. Here are some essential etiquette tips.
- Greetings: A simple nod or smile is generally appreciated. When greeting someone older than you, a slight bow shows respect.
- Dress Code: Dress modestly, especially when visiting religious sites or local villages. Avoid wearing revealing clothing.
- Shoes: Remove your shoes when entering someone’s home or a temple.
- Eating: Use chopsticks correctly and avoid sticking them upright in your rice bowl, as this resembles a funeral ritual.
- Pointing: Avoid pointing with your finger; instead, use your open hand to indicate direction.
- Touching: Avoid touching someone’s head, as it is considered the most sacred part of the body.
- Photography: Always ask for permission before taking someone’s photo, especially in rural areas.
- Bargaining: Bargaining is common in markets, but do so respectfully and with a smile.
- Gifts: When giving a gift, use both hands to show respect.
- Noise: Keep noise levels down, especially in quiet areas and during religious ceremonies.

15. Essential Vietnamese Phrases for Your Trip
Learning a few basic Vietnamese phrases can greatly enhance your interactions with locals and make your trip more enjoyable.
- Hello: Xin chào (sin CHOW)
- Thank you: Cảm ơn (gahm UHn)
- You’re welcome: Không có gì (khawng KAW zee)
- Please: Làm ơn (lahm uhn)
- Yes: Vâng (vuhng)
- No: Không (khawng)
- Excuse me: Xin lỗi (sin loy)
- How much?: Bao nhiêu? (baw nyew)
- Where is…?: … ở đâu? (uh dow)
- I don’t understand: Tôi không hiểu (toy khawng hyew)
- Help!: Cứu tôi! (koo toy)
- Delicious: Ngon quá (ngawng KWAH)
- Cheers!: Dô! (yo)
